Delek: Leviathan gas flows start

Delek Group said that partners in the Leviathan project have commenced the supply of natural gas from the field.

The capacity of natural gas flow from the Leviathan reservoir is expected to ramp up gradually and accordingly, in the coming days, natural gas supply from the reservoir to Egypt will also commence, Delek said in its statement.

To remind, the operator of the project Noble Energy has executed multiple agreements to support the delivery of natural gas from the Leviathan and Tamar fields, offshore Israel, into Egypt.

The company anticipates selling at least 350 million cubic feet of natural gas per day, gross, to contracted customers in Egypt.

The Leviathan project is operated by Noble Energy with a 39.66 percent working interest, with other interest owners being Delek Drilling with 22.67 percent, Avner Oil Exploration with 22.67 percent, and Ratio Oil Exploration (1992) Limited Partnership with the remaining 15 percent.
